Agree with this. It should be the overall wheel diameter. Ideally, it doesn't matter even if 15" or 17" mags as long as the right profile of tire will be used to maintained the overall wheel diameter.
The problem with the stock 15s I think is the high profile of the tire. After a while, the rubber sidewall sags even if you maintain the tire pressure. So in effect, you will have a shorter wheel radius, a little bit higher speedo readings than actual and a lower ground clearance
The difference with using a 17s mags is that the rubber is less and therefore the sag is less also. Metal don't compress as oppose to rubber. And therefore, you will have a more accurate speedo reading using 17s. Mine even have an oversize tire, mas higher ground clearance at mas matipid pa sa fuel
